Output dd72e17be4ba1e0b813e01defef01b499de895db3603d784a9e5dfb6381ca005:3

value
118890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 288f987f5a886f53921acaf3baf71a3ff06de95f OP_EQUAL
address
35PUyRMKdt6DTNzwywdBM42TCGDgA2bhnz
transaction
dd72e17be4ba1e0b813e01defef01b499de895db3603d784a9e5dfb6381ca005
confirmations
309225
spent
true